Questions & Answers

Q: How did the speaker's upbringing in India contribute to her understanding of home?

The speaker grew up moving homes frequently and despite the changes, always felt a sense of belonging due to her family's constant presence.

Q: How did the speaker's move to the United States challenge her sense of home?

The speaker experienced a shift in identity as she tried to fit into the American culture while holding onto her Indian roots, leading to a questioning of where home truly is.

Q: What role did love play in the speaker's journey of finding home?

Love led the speaker to move to France, where she had to adapt to a new culture and language. However, her relationship and connection with her new family helped her create a sense of home.

Q: How did the death of the speaker's father impact her understanding of home and identity?

The death of her father made the speaker reflect on her sense of home and forced her to confront questions of identity and belonging. It made her realize that home is not solely built on external factors.

Summary & Key Takeaways

  • The speaker reflects on her childhood in India, where she felt a sense of belonging despite moving homes frequently.

  • She then moves to the United States for her PhD and embraces a new cultural identity while still holding onto her Indian roots.

  • The speaker later moves to France for love, facing challenges with language and cultural assimilation, but finding a sense of home within her new family.
